Output 08823642172434cf5949c7e26f8c7e20b88241d44c83f6f3232e14a489085dac:38

value
588950
script pubkey
OP_0 OP_PUSHBYTES_32 9b36bd9ae8c6a832339ee3459423adcbc077dc995954c45716eb8e8cd345951a
address
bc1qnvmtmxhgc65ryvu7udzeggade0q80hyet92vg4ckaw8ge569j5dq5294d4
transaction
08823642172434cf5949c7e26f8c7e20b88241d44c83f6f3232e14a489085dac
spent
true